Graduate Certificate in Electric Aircraft Thermal Management Applications
-- ViewingNowThe Graduate Certificate in Electric Aircraft Thermal Management Applications is a vital course designed to meet the growing demand for professionals skilled in electric aircraft technology. This program equips learners with essential skills in thermal management, a critical aspect of electric aircraft design and operation.

コース詳細
- Electric Aircraft Thermal Management Fundamentals
- Thermodynamics and Heat Transfer Principles in Electric Aircraft
- Electric Aircraft Power Systems and Thermal Management
- Battery Thermal Management for Electric Aircraft
- Thermal Modeling and Simulation for Electric Aircraft Applications
- Advanced Cooling Techniques in Electric Aircraft
- Thermal Testing and Diagnostics for Electric Aircraft
- Sustainable and Efficient Thermal Management Solutions for Electric Aircraft
- Regulatory Compliance and Standards in Electric Aircraft Thermal Management
